In November, Brazil experienced a decrease in federal tax collection, totaling R$ 172.038 billion ($35.1 billion). This represents a 0.39% drop in real terms from the same month in 2022. Chile Expects 0.4% Economic Drop in 2023
Chile’s Central Bank says market experts predict a 0.4% fall in the economy for 2023. However, they forecast a 1.8% growth for 2024. For this quarter, a minor 0.1% rise is expected. Venezuela and Barbados conclude agri-food and air services agreements
Venezuela and Barbados have reached agreements on agri-food and air service matters. The meeting in Caracas between Venezuelan President Nicolás Maduro and Barbadian Prime Minister Mia Mottley resulted in these significant pacts, aimed at strengthening cooperation between the two nations.
